Bienvenue au Best Western Hotel Nettuno, un hôtel 4 étoiles situé dans la charmante ville de Brindisi, en Italie. Avec son adresse privilégiée au 41 Via Angelo Titi, l'hôtel est à seulement 1,1mi du centre-ville animé, offrant un accès facile aux attractions et commodités de la ville.

En entrant dans l'hôtel, vous serez accueilli par le personnel chaleureux et amical à la réception ouverte 24h/24. L'hôtel dispose d'un éventail d'équipements fantastiques pour garantir un séjour confortable. Profitez de la vue pittoresque sur l'océan depuis la terrasse ou le solarium, détendez-vous dans le centre de remise en forme, ou relaxez-vous dans le jardin magnifiquement paysagé. L'hôtel propose également un parking privé gratuit et une connexion Wi-Fi gratuite dans tout l'établissement.

Have to admit I wasn't expecting much for a port hotel but we were pleasantly surprised. The decor is quite 90's looking but it was all maintained very well and it was clean and comfortable. The rooms were a very good size and had a very comfy bed and was very clean. Breakfast was good and the staff very friendly and helpful. The only thing I would say was the location is not great if you want to go out in the town of Brindisi. The hotel is located in a bit of a ghost town of the port and warehouses so you definitely need a taxi to get to the town but if you want a hotel to access the ferry going to Greece, it is a perfect location. We stayed with our two dogs and they were very sweet with the pets.

This is the perfect stopover after arriving on the daytime ferry from Greece. It's just a stone's throw from the ferry port in the middle of the industrial estate and looks unpreposessing from the outside, but it's not somewhere you stay for old-town charm; rather, it offers a good dinner, plenty of easy and free parking, very large comfortable beds, it's pet-friendly and has an excellent breakfast to set you up perfectly for your journey the next day. It's more expensive than I normally like to pay; but the location and aforementioned benefits make it worth the money.

Property is lovely. Lots of palm trees and views across to Brindisi harbour. About 15 minutes from Brindisi centre, ideal for a stay and a flight. The rooms are spacious and well looked after. The staff were really accommodating, the food was excellent and value for money. A very spacious ground floor with a bar and plenty of outside space. Plenty of free onsite parking and English is spoken here as well.
